Ticket LKR-412: Signature verification fails on the laundry-locker access flow when a resident's unlock token is refreshed mid-session. The Wringly gateway rejects the payload with SIG_MISMATCH, but only on lockers provisioned after the v3.2 rollout. I traced it to the firmware bundler signing against the legacy chain instead of the current one. For review, please confirm the fix re-signs against the correct chain. The expected signing key is as follows:

rollout seal: bky4_yke3

Capacity note for the Fennelgrid sidecar review. Aggregation window widened to cut emit rate; per-pod memory ceiling holds at current cardinality (~12k series). CPU flat. Risk: buffer overflow if a tenant spikes labels — mitigated by the drop policy. No node-pool changes needed for the Caldermoor cluster this quarter. Review the flush and buffer settings before merge. Constants under review are below.

limits module of yafop-hahag:
QUOTAS = {
    "tamwyn": 652,
    "prawyn": 731,
}

Ticket: QRM-legacy ORM refactor, phase 2. New folks: don't touch the `mapper_old` package directly; shim everything through `storebridge`. This ticket tracks removing the last four raw-cursor call sites in the billing module at Pellhaven. Run the migration test suite locally before pushing. Paste the passing build token below.

pipeline stamp: htk9_ce63042d9

## Deployment

The Pixelgrove EXIF scrubber runs as a sidecar in front of the upload service. Before promoting a release, confirm the scrub policy strips GPS tags, serial numbers, and maker notes while preserving orientation. Rolling restarts are safe; in-flight uploads are re-queued automatically. The production configuration the release must ship with is shown below.

deployment values, kajep-kageg:
[praix]
host = praix.paliqcorp.corp
user = praix_svc
database = praix_prod